This article, "Brief but Intense Exercise May Thwart Diabetes," describes a study that showed doing brief 3 minute high-intense exercises significantly improves measures dealing w/ Diabetes.
Over the course of 2 weeks, the participants completed 6 sessions of supervised high-intensity interval training. Each session consisted of four-to-six 30-second sprints on a stationary bicycle.
